基于数学形态学的非线性语音增强方法

摘    要:为了更好地滤除语音信号中的宽带噪声,使语音增强向着非线性方向发展。综合考虑语音和噪声特性,选用合理的结构元素,设计了一种新的形态学滤波算法,构造出用于语音信号滤波增强的非线性形态滤波器。仿真实验和数据分析结果论证了这种基于形态学的非线性语音增强方法的可行性,尤其是对于正负脉冲噪声的滤除效果相对较好。

关 键 词:语音增强  非线性  形态学滤波  结构元素

Non-linear Speech Enhancement Method Based on Mathematical Morphology

Abstract:Non-linear method is the trend of speech enhancement,especially for the speech signal corrupted by wideband noise.In this paper,considering the properties both of the speech and noise signal,a non-llnear morphological filter is designed for suppressing the noises embedded in speech signal.This new tilter,known from the conventional ones, is based on a new morphological filtering algorithm with appropriate structuring element.Simulations results confirm the feasibility and superiority over removing the pulse noise of this new approach.
Keywords:speech enhancement  non-linear  morphological filtering  structuring element
